....at (Page Nos. 456 to 467 of the paper book). 23.2 The CD has defaulted in making repayment of loan/credit facilities to the Petitioner Bank and the date of default is 31.03.2014. The Statement of accounts and the CIBIL Reports submitted by the applicant Bank confirm the default committed by the Corporate Debtor. 23.3 The Petitioner Bank has filed the petition within the period of limitation, as the date of mortgage of the property is 15.06.2009, SARFAESI proceeding initiated on 17.10.2014, DRT proceedings started in 2014 and the Credits have come into the loan accounts on 04/03/2015. 23.4 Revival letters have been executed on 07/12/2010, 04/05/2012, 09/01/2014. Corporate Debtor has acknowledged the debts of the Applicant by creating charge with ROC, Ahmedabad in favour of Financial Creditor on various dates including 25/08/2008, 24/02/2009, 13/05/2014 & 11/01/2017. Corporate Debtor also filed Balance Sheet with ROC upto 31/03/2017 acknowledging their liability to the Applicant bank. 23.5 Corporate Debtor offered OTS proposed on 27/02/2018 for Rs. 15.50 Crores to Rs. 16.25 Crores referring the earlier correspondence on 27/11/2017, 20/01/2018 and JLF meeting on 26/12/2017....

....6. As per the provisions of Sections 13 and 14 of the I.B. Code on the date of commencement of insolvency, this Adjudicating Authority declares moratorium with effect from today is 18/12/2019 for prohibiting all of the following, namely: - I. (a) The institution of suits or continuation of pending suits or proceedings against the corporate debtor including execution of any judgment, decree or order in any Court of Law, Tribunal arbitration panel or other authority. (b) Transferring, encumbering, alienating or disposing of by the corporate debtor any of its assets or any legal right or beneficial interest therein. (c) Any action to foreclose, recover or enforce any security interest created by the corporate debtor in respect of its property including any action under the Securitisation and Reconstruction of Financial Assets and Enforcement of Security Interest Act, 2002 (54 of 2002). (d) The recovery of any property by an owner or lessor where such property is occupied by or in the possession of the corporate debtor. II.
